    Really a disappointment. Really more like 1.5 stars, but I rounded up. Didn't check rating first since we were going to try to eat at the El Mundo patio but it was closed. The good news: - The staff is attentive. We were seated outside on an unseasonably warm February night. - The portions are generous. TONS of shredded chicken on my taco salad. Wish it actually had more lettuce. - Chicken tortilla soup is decent, but oily. - the ladies restroom was average, but still funky smelling. The bad news: - Not one, but two screwed up drink orders in a row. - Easily the worst, watered down margarita I've ever had. - The free tortilla chips had a weird chemically taste. - No soup containers to take to go. They gave me a foil container with a plastic lid that didn't seal in liquid. - Food was bland and chicken was dry and not shredded up very well. - After picking up our plates, we waited and waited for our check to arrive. Finally went inside to use the restroom and he asked if we were ready for our check. Ummm, yah. Then took his sweet time coming back with the card. Really no reason to ever go back.

    Delicious margaritas & chorizo that isn't greasy! Was walking to a nearby store and noticed this place advertising their drink specials & decided to stop in, glad I did! We were seated immediately & received warm chips with salsa. I ordered the pineapple margarita and it was made with real pineapple. My husband & I split a huge burrito, it was large enough where both of us were full at the end. The chorizo on top was not greasy & made it delicious, one of the few chorizos I've ever liked. We came in at an awkward time (about 4) so it was a little quieter but by the time we left more guests were arriving. Would visit again!
